
数据分析没有log文件可以通过使用数据挖掘技术、数据可视化工具、数据恢复软件、日志模拟工具、FineBI等方法进行解决。其中,FineBI 是一种强大的数据可视化和分析工具,可以帮助用户在没有log文件的情况下进行数据分析。FineBI不仅可以从多种数据源中提取数据,还可以将数据进行可视化展示,使用户能够更直观地了解数据的趋势和模式。FineBI官网: https://s.fanruan.com/f459r;
一、数据挖掘技术
数据挖掘技术可以帮助我们从大量的原始数据中提取有用的信息和知识。通过使用各种算法,如分类、聚类、关联规则挖掘等,我们可以发现数据中的潜在模式和关系。例如,如果我们没有log文件,但有访问网站的原始数据记录,我们可以通过分类算法来识别用户行为模式,通过聚类算法来发现相似用户群体,通过关联规则挖掘来找出常见的访问路径。
数据挖掘的主要步骤包括数据预处理、数据变换、数据挖掘、模式评估和知识表示。在数据预处理阶段,我们需要清洗和转换原始数据,以去除噪声和不一致的数据。在数据变换阶段,我们需要将数据转换成适合挖掘的形式。在数据挖掘阶段,我们使用各种算法来挖掘数据中的模式。在模式评估阶段,我们评估挖掘出的模式是否有用。在知识表示阶段,我们将有用的模式转换成易于理解的形式。
数据挖掘技术的应用范围非常广泛,包括市场分析、客户关系管理、风险管理、网络安全等。通过使用数据挖掘技术,我们可以在没有log文件的情况下,从原始数据中提取有价值的信息和知识。
二、数据可视化工具
数据可视化工具可以帮助我们将数据转换成图表和图形,使我们能够更直观地理解数据。FineBI 是一种强大的数据可视化工具,可以从多种数据源中提取数据,并将数据进行可视化展示。FineBI 支持多种图表类型,如折线图、柱状图、饼图、散点图等,用户可以根据需要选择合适的图表类型来展示数据。
使用 FineBI 进行数据可视化的步骤包括数据连接、数据处理、图表创建和图表展示。在数据连接阶段,我们需要连接数据源,如数据库、Excel 文件等。在数据处理阶段,我们可以对数据进行清洗、转换和聚合。在图表创建阶段,我们可以选择合适的图表类型,并将数据拖放到图表中。在图表展示阶段,我们可以对图表进行调整和美化,使其更易于理解。
FineBI 的另一个重要功能是数据仪表盘。数据仪表盘可以将多个图表组合在一起,形成一个综合的视图,用户可以通过仪表盘来监控关键指标和数据变化。FineBI 还支持数据过滤、钻取、联动等功能,使用户能够对数据进行深入分析。
通过使用 FineBI 等数据可视化工具,我们可以在没有log文件的情况下,通过图表和图形来理解数据的趋势和模式,从而进行数据分析。
三、数据恢复软件
数据恢复软件可以帮助我们恢复丢失或损坏的数据文件,包括log文件。常见的数据恢复软件有 Disk Drill、Recuva、EaseUS Data Recovery Wizard 等。这些软件可以扫描存储设备,如硬盘、U盘、SD卡等,找到丢失或损坏的文件,并将其恢复。
使用数据恢复软件的步骤包括下载和安装软件、选择扫描模式、扫描存储设备、预览和恢复文件。在下载和安装软件阶段,我们需要从官方网站下载并安装数据恢复软件。在选择扫描模式阶段,我们可以选择快速扫描或深度扫描。快速扫描速度较快,但可能无法找到所有丢失的文件;深度扫描速度较慢,但可以找到更多的文件。在扫描存储设备阶段,软件会扫描存储设备上的所有文件,并显示扫描结果。在预览和恢复文件阶段,我们可以预览扫描到的文件,并选择要恢复的文件进行恢复。
数据恢复软件的效果取决于文件丢失或损坏的原因和时间。如果文件被覆盖或损坏严重,数据恢复软件可能无法完全恢复文件。但即使在这种情况下,数据恢复软件也可以帮助我们找回部分数据,提供有用的信息。
通过使用数据恢复软件,我们可以在没有log文件的情况下,尝试恢复丢失或损坏的log文件,从而进行数据分析。
四、日志模拟工具
日志模拟工具可以帮助我们生成模拟的log文件,供数据分析使用。常见的日志模拟工具有 Apache JMeter、Logstash、Splunk 等。这些工具可以生成各种格式和内容的log文件,模拟不同的系统和应用场景。
使用日志模拟工具的步骤包括下载和安装工具、配置日志生成规则、生成日志文件、分析日志文件。在下载和安装工具阶段,我们需要从官方网站下载并安装日志模拟工具。在配置日志生成规则阶段,我们可以根据需要配置日志生成的格式、内容、频率等。在生成日志文件阶段,工具会根据配置规则生成模拟的log文件。在分析日志文件阶段,我们可以使用数据分析工具,如 FineBI、Excel、Python 等,对生成的log文件进行分析。
日志模拟工具的优点是可以根据需要生成各种格式和内容的log文件,灵活性和可定制性强。通过使用日志模拟工具,我们可以在没有真实log文件的情况下,生成模拟的log文件,供数据分析使用。
五、FineBI
FineBI 是一种强大的数据可视化和分析工具,可以帮助用户在没有log文件的情况下进行数据分析。FineBI 可以从多种数据源中提取数据,如数据库、Excel 文件、API 接口等,并将数据进行可视化展示,使用户能够更直观地了解数据的趋势和模式。
FineBI 的主要功能包括数据连接、数据处理、图表创建、数据仪表盘、数据过滤、钻取、联动等。用户可以通过 FineBI 的拖拽式操作界面,轻松完成数据分析任务。FineBI 还支持多种图表类型,如折线图、柱状图、饼图、散点图等,用户可以根据需要选择合适的图表类型来展示数据。
使用 FineBI 进行数据分析的步骤包括数据连接、数据处理、图表创建和图表展示。在数据连接阶段,用户可以连接数据源,如数据库、Excel 文件等。在数据处理阶段,用户可以对数据进行清洗、转换和聚合。在图表创建阶段,用户可以选择合适的图表类型,并将数据拖放到图表中。在图表展示阶段,用户可以对图表进行调整和美化,使其更易于理解。
FineBI 的数据仪表盘功能可以将多个图表组合在一起,形成一个综合的视图,用户可以通过仪表盘来监控关键指标和数据变化。FineBI 还支持数据过滤、钻取、联动等功能,使用户能够对数据进行深入分析。
通过使用 FineBI,我们可以在没有log文件的情况下,通过可视化图表和数据仪表盘来理解数据的趋势和模式,从而进行数据分析。FineBI官网: https://s.fanruan.com/f459r;
六、数据源整合
数据源整合可以帮助我们将分散在不同位置的数据汇集在一起,进行统一的分析。常见的数据源包括数据库、Excel 文件、API 接口、云存储等。通过整合这些数据源,我们可以获取更多的数据,为数据分析提供支持。
数据源整合的主要步骤包括数据源识别、数据源连接、数据整合、数据处理和数据分析。在数据源识别阶段,我们需要识别所有可能的数据源,包括结构化数据和非结构化数据。在数据源连接阶段,我们需要连接所有识别到的数据源。在数据整合阶段,我们需要将来自不同数据源的数据进行合并和转换,使其具有一致的格式和结构。在数据处理阶段,我们需要对整合后的数据进行清洗、转换和聚合。在数据分析阶段,我们可以使用数据分析工具,如 FineBI,对整合后的数据进行分析。
数据源整合的挑战在于数据的异构性和复杂性。不同数据源的数据格式和结构可能不同,数据质量可能不一致。为了应对这些挑战,我们可以使用数据转换工具,如 ETL 工具,来进行数据转换和整合。
通过数据源整合,我们可以在没有log文件的情况下,获取更多的数据,为数据分析提供支持。
七、数据模拟
数据模拟可以帮助我们生成模拟的数据,供数据分析使用。常见的数据模拟方法包括随机生成、规则生成、历史数据回放等。通过数据模拟,我们可以在没有真实数据的情况下,生成模拟的数据,进行数据分析。
数据模拟的主要步骤包括数据需求分析、数据生成规则设计、数据生成、数据验证和数据分析。在数据需求分析阶段,我们需要明确需要生成的数据类型、格式和内容。在数据生成规则设计阶段,我们需要设计数据生成的规则,如随机生成规则、规则生成规则、历史数据回放规则等。在数据生成阶段,我们根据设计的规则生成模拟的数据。在数据验证阶段,我们需要验证生成的数据是否符合需求。在数据分析阶段,我们可以使用数据分析工具,如 FineBI,对生成的数据进行分析。
数据模拟的优点是可以根据需要生成各种类型和内容的数据,灵活性和可定制性强。通过数据模拟,我们可以在没有真实数据的情况下,生成模拟的数据,进行数据分析。
八、人工智能技术
人工智能技术可以帮助我们在没有log文件的情况下,进行数据分析。常见的人工智能技术包括机器学习、深度学习、自然语言处理等。通过使用人工智能技术,我们可以从数据中自动提取特征和模式,进行预测和分析。
使用人工智能技术进行数据分析的主要步骤包括数据收集、数据预处理、特征提取、模型训练、模型评估和模型应用。在数据收集阶段,我们需要收集足够的训练数据。在数据预处理阶段,我们需要对数据进行清洗、转换和归一化。在特征提取阶段,我们需要从数据中提取有用的特征。在模型训练阶段,我们使用训练数据训练模型。在模型评估阶段,我们评估模型的性能。在模型应用阶段,我们使用训练好的模型进行预测和分析。
人工智能技术的优点是可以从大量数据中自动提取特征和模式,进行高效的预测和分析。通过使用人工智能技术,我们可以在没有log文件的情况下,进行数据分析。
通过上述方法,我们可以在没有log文件的情况下,进行数据分析。不同的方法有不同的优点和适用场景,用户可以根据实际需求选择合适的方法进行数据分析。FineBI 作为一种强大的数据可视化和分析工具,可以帮助用户在没有log文件的情况下,通过可视化图表和数据仪表盘来理解数据的趋势和模式,从而进行数据分析。FineBI官网: https://s.fanruan.com/f459r;
相关问答FAQs:
数据分析没有log文件吗怎么办?
在进行数据分析时,log文件扮演着重要的角色,它记录了系统运行的状态、错误信息以及用户操作等信息。然而,有时由于某种原因,log文件可能缺失或无法访问,这会给数据分析带来一定的困难。以下是一些应对这种情况的方法。
-
检查数据源和系统设置
首先,检查数据源和系统设置,确保log文件的生成没有被禁用。在一些系统中,log记录功能可能因配置问题而无法正常工作。查看系统的配置文件或管理界面,确保相关的log记录选项已启用。 -
利用其他日志记录工具
如果原有的log文件无法使用,可以考虑使用其他日志记录工具来替代。许多现代数据分析工具和平台(如Apache Kafka、Logstash等)都提供了强大的日志记录功能,可以帮助捕捉和记录系统的各类信息。通过配置这些工具,可以将相关数据重新记录下来,以便后续分析。 -
从备份中恢复数据
如果log文件曾经存在但由于某种原因被删除或丢失,可以尝试从备份中恢复数据。定期备份数据是良好的数据管理习惯,确保在发生意外时能够快速恢复。检查是否有可用的备份文件,并使用相应的工具进行恢复。 -
追踪用户行为
尽管没有log文件,依然可以通过追踪用户行为来获取一些有价值的信息。例如,使用数据分析工具的内置功能,查看用户的操作记录、访问次数和时间等。这些信息虽然不如log文件详细,但仍然可以为分析提供一定的支持。 -
重新进行数据采集
如果没有任何可以利用的log文件,可能需要考虑重新进行数据采集。这意味着需要从头开始收集相关数据,可能需要一些时间和精力,但这是确保数据完整性的重要步骤。通过建立新的数据采集流程,确保未来的数据能够被妥善记录。 -
进行异常分析
在没有log文件的情况下,进行异常分析可能会变得更加复杂。但可以通过其他的数据指标和趋势来识别潜在的问题。例如,通过分析系统性能指标、用户反馈等,找出异常点。这种方法虽然不如log文件直接,但可以帮助识别问题。 -
咨询专业人员
如果自己无法解决log文件缺失的问题,可以考虑咨询专业的数据分析师或IT支持人员。他们可能具备更丰富的经验和技术手段,能够帮助你找到有效的解决方案。 -
改进数据管理策略
为了避免未来再次出现log文件缺失的问题,建议改进数据管理策略。这包括定期检查log文件的状态、确保系统配置正确、实施数据备份策略等。通过制定详细的数据管理计划,可以减少数据丢失的风险。
如何防止数据分析中log文件的丢失?
在数据分析中,log文件的丢失可能会对分析结果产生重大影响,因此采取措施防止其丢失至关重要。以下是一些有效的策略:
-
定期备份log文件
确保定期对log文件进行备份。可以设置自动备份机制,定期将log文件复制到安全的存储位置。这样,即使原始文件丢失,也可以轻松恢复。 -
监控log文件的状态
实施监控机制,实时监测log文件的状态。一旦发现文件异常(如文件大小突然减少或文件无法访问),可以及时采取措施,避免数据的进一步损失。 -
采用可靠的存储解决方案
使用可靠的存储解决方案来保存log文件。选择稳定的云存储或本地服务器,确保数据的安全性和可访问性。此外,确保存储设备定期进行维护,以防止因硬件故障导致的数据丢失。 -
设定权限管理
对log文件的访问进行权限管理,限制只有授权人员才能访问和修改文件。这样可以减少人为操作失误导致的文件丢失或损坏的风险。 -
使用版本控制系统
将log文件纳入版本控制系统(如Git)进行管理。版本控制可以记录文件的每次更改,确保在文件丢失或损坏时,可以快速恢复到之前的版本。 -
定期审计和评估
定期对数据管理策略进行审计和评估,找出潜在的风险和改进机会。这可以帮助及时发现并解决问题,确保log文件的安全和完整。 -
建立应急响应机制
制定应急响应计划,确保在log文件丢失时能够快速采取行动。这包括明确责任人、制定恢复流程和资源准备等,确保团队能够迅速响应并采取适当措施。
通过以上措施,不仅可以有效防止log文件的丢失,还能提高数据管理的整体水平,确保数据分析工作的顺利进行。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



